Many ways to design, build, test, and prototype

The fabrication area is divided into several specialised sections that allow for printing (3D, graphic, large-format, UV), cutting (laser), and working with a wide variety of materials such as wood, metal, ceramics, and textiles.
Within these workshops, dedicated design studios are reserved for the school’s students, providing spaces to develop both individual and group projects.
